SYDNEY - AussieJournal -- Regular maintenance is the best step toward the creation of a durable and reliable air conditioning system. Much like any mechanical equipment, HVAC systems have to be serviced regularly. Experts recommend maintenance twice a year, usually just before the peak of the summer and winter seasons. During these sessions, the professional HVAC technician will inspect your system for wear, clean important components, and, if necessary, make any needed repairs or adjustments. This proactive approach helps to identify issues at an early stage before minor problems develop into major breakdowns, hence dollars in uptime cost to your business.
These will include, but are not limited to, inspection and tightening of electrical connections, lubrication of all moving parts, making sure the condensate drain works, and verification of the thermostat accuracy. In addition to that, they will evaluate the general condition of the system and make sure it is ready for the coming season. This investment will help work the air conditioner for a longer period of time and make your energy bill is lower, as it will work more efficiently.

Proper Air Flow
Over time, restricted airflow results in higher energy usage, increased component wear, and a shorter life cycle for your air conditioner.
Do check your HVAC system for any kind of obstruction to the airflow on a regular basis. This would include checking to ensure that furniture, equipment, or other items are not blocking the registers or return air inlet, as well as checking for dust and debris in ductwork. In some cases, professional duct cleaning is necessary to remove accumulated contaminants that may be interfering with airflow.
